Tyler the Creator & Fortnite collaboration rumors: Rocket League tease & more

(Courtesy : Tyler the Creator, Epic Games)
Possible two collabs with the games
Fortnite fans and players are currently enjoying Fortnitemares 2025, but the recent rumors and leaks have hyped them even more.
Popular leakers SamLeakss and Hypex have revealed that we might see a new collaboration with Tyler the Creator. This rapper has been dropping banger after banger for over a decade. Let’s check out more details in this article.
Tease with Fortnite & Rocket League
The recent rumors and leaks suggest that Tyler’s collaboration is coming with Rocket League and is possible with Fortnite as well. Rocket League is partnered with Epic Games, so this crossover isn’t that wild.
Tyler’s “Don’t Tap the Glass” title has been spotted in the Rocket League files, which match his latest album drop. At the same time, fans and leakers are speculating that we might see the collaboration with Epic Games as well.
As seen from the past, Rocket League collaboration has also ended up in Fortnite as well. So it won’t be surprising to see Tyler joining the battle royale madness later on.
It may be his songs, a festival event, or even he might get his own skin. Recently, we have seen many rappers and singers collaborating with Epic Games.
Eminem, Snoop Dogg, Doja Cat, Lady Gaga, Sabrina Carpenter, Billie Eilish and so many other artists as well. Tyler joining the lineup is only fair, as he has been a dominant rapper for a decade now.

FAQs
Is Tyler the Creator confirmed for Fortnite?
Not yet—it’s all rumor based on Rocket League leaks and Hypex intel, but Epic’s history with artists like Billie Eilish makes it highly likely.
What’s the Rocket League connection to Tyler?
Rocket League teased “Don’t Tap the Glass” (Tyler’s album title), and since Epic owns both, fans expect a crossover like past shared collabs.
